Delayed Periods
I had sex with my husband last month on 18th and got my periods on 19th morning after that I didn't had sex but my periods are delayed in this month so I'm afraid of being pregnant what should I do? Is it possible to be pregnant in my case although I had used condom

It is unlikely that you are pregnant. But you can get urine pregnancy test done. After that connect online for detailed evaluation and prescription
